Jeff Turcotte was viewed as a promising prospect in the 1975 NFL Draft. His combination of arm talent, mobility, and leadership made him an intriguing option for teams looking for a quarterback. However, his inconsistency and decision-making skills raised questions among scouts. Potentially a mid-round selection, Turcotte had the upside to develop into a starting quarterback with the right coaching and experience.
